Cody Martin is an American professional basketball player currently donning a jersey of the Charlotte Hornets in the NBA. Hailing from Winston-Salem, North Carolina, Martin has the privilege to play for his hometown team.

Cody Martin began his basketball career alongside his twin brother Caleb Martin at Davie County High School in Mocksville, North Carolina. After a couple of years, Cody and his brother transferred to Oak Hill Academy, a renowned prep powerhouse. During his college years, Martin spent two seasons at NC State before transferring to Nevada, where he played for another two years.

In the 2019 NBA Draft, Cody Martin was selected 36th overall by the Charlotte Hornets. In his first two seasons in the NBA, Martin showed steady growth as a two-way player. He was mostly known for his athletic abilities and attacking the rim. He was trying to mold his game as a 3-&-D wing player. Over the years, his defense improved and now, Cody is seen as an off-the-bench impactful defender.

The 2021-22 NBA season saw Martin having a breakout year as he established himself as an elite two-way option for the Hornets. Charlotte showed confidence in him by extending his contract, signaling their belief in his long-term potential and importance to the team.

How much is Cody Martin getting paid?

Cody Martin is slated to earn $7,560,000 for the 2023/24 NBA season as per his contract with the Charlotte Hornets.

According to Spotrac, Martin signed a lucrative four-year, $31,360,000 contract with the Charlotte Hornets on July 31st, 2019. Notably, only the three years, worth $22,680,000, is guaranteed. The last year of the contract in 2025-26 is non-guaranteed.

What are the terms of Cody Martin’ contract?

Cody Martin’ current contract comes with a distinctive set of terms. While the initial three years are guaranteed, the fourth year is subject to non-guarantee. The contract states that the Hornets team management holds the authority to decide if they wish to bring Cody back for the final season or not.

The team can choose to keep the contract for only three years based on certain undisclosed terms. This potentially allows Cody Martin to become a free agent after only three seasons. Consequently, the duration of Cody's contract could end in the 2025 offseason or extend until the 2026 offseason.

How much of the Cody Martin Contract is guaranteed?

Only three years out of a four year contract are guaranteed for Cody Martin. It is worth $22,680,000.

Cody Martin Contract History

These are all the contracts that Cody Martin has signed in his career till now.

July 31, 2019

Cody Martin signed a three-year $4.47 million rookie contract with Charlotte Hornets.

July 6, 2022

Martin agreed to sign a four-year $31.36 million contract with the Hornets.
